Quality Engineer (Manufacturing)
Abingdon, Oxfordshire
45,000 - 50,000 + Training + Progression + 33 Days Holiday + Company Pension

Excellent opportunity for a Quality Engineer from a manufacturing environment who is looking to work for a leading manufacturing company who can also offer ongoing technical development with specialist training.

Do you have experience managing quality standards and protocols in a manufacturing environment? Are you looking for training and progression within a company who are in a rapid phase of expansion?

This company have been established for over 60 years and specialise in the manufacture of high precision components for a long list of prestigious clients. With ongoing investment they are rapidly expanding across all areas of the business. Due to their continued success they are now looking to add to their specialist team.

In this role you will be working to manage the quality standards and procedures of the business as well as identifying areas for improvement where possible. They work to highly regulated industries so a keen eye for detail and investigating NCR's using quality methodologies. This role allows further development through ongoing training as well as future progression opportunities as the company continues to expand.

The Role:

  • Ensuring compliance to highly regulated quality standards
  • Working with high precision components and parts to international clients
  • Opportunity for ongoing training and progression

The Person:

  • Quality Engineer from a manufacturing background
  • Skilled in inspection techniques and producing reports
  • Looking for progression and training opportunities with a market leading company
